Om te streven naar een sneller internet heeft Google verschillende richtlijnen en hulpprogramma's geïntroduceerd waarmee u uw website kunt optimaliseren zodat deze sneller wordt geladen. Als u alle stappen hebt gevolgd, zoals het instellen van CDN, het verkleinen van CSS en javascripts, en vindt dat uw website nog steeds niet zo snel wordt geladen als u wilde, dan is het het beste om de Paginasnelheid-service van Google in te stellen en Google optimaliseren en serveren van uw website voor u.

Hoe Paginasnelheidsservice werkt?

Het concept achter de PageSpeed-service is eenvoudig. Nadat u het hebt ingesteld, pakt Google een kopie van uw website, optimaliseert deze en slaat deze op in zijn server. Wanneer een verzoek wordt gedaan op uw website, wordt de geoptimaliseerde en in het cachegeheugenversie van de server van Google geserveerd in plaats van de kopie van uw eigen server.

eis

Er zijn een paar dingen die u moet vervullen voordat u gebruik kunt maken van de PageSpeed-service.

1. Uw domeinnaam moet het voorvoegsel 'www' bevatten (bijvoorbeeld http://www.example.com). Kale domeinen zoals 'http://example.com' (zonder het www) worden momenteel niet ondersteund.

2. U moet de CNAME- en Hostrecord van uw domein kunnen wijzigen. Als u uw domeinnaam bij uw webhost hebt geregistreerd, moet u contact opnemen met uw webhost en hen vragen de CNAME-record voor u te wijzigen.

Paginasnelheidservice instellen op uw website

1. Ga naar deze pagina en klik op de knop "Nu aanmelden".

Opmerking : Paginaspeed-service is momenteel alleen-uitnodiging. Het zal enige tijd duren voordat Google uw aanvraag goedkeurt en u een uitnodiging stuurt. Ik heb mijn uitnodiging ontvangen in minder dan een uur na het indienen van het aanmeldingsformulier, maar je aantal kilometers zal variëren.

2. Nadat u uw uitnodiging heeft ontvangen, gaat u naar de Google API-pagina en klikt u op de koppeling "Paginasnelheidsservice" in de zijbalk.

3. Voer in het gedeelte "Nieuw domein toevoegen" het domein van uw website in. Zorg ervoor dat u de "http: //" uitsluit en neem de "www" op voor uw domeinnaam.

Opmerking : als u uw website nog niet eerder in Google Webmaster heeft geverifieerd, wordt u gevraagd uw website te verifiëren voordat u verder kunt gaan.

Wanneer u deze stap hebt voltooid, bent u klaar met het configureren van de Google PageSpeed-service voor uw website. De volgende stap is het wijzigen van de CNAME-record van uw domein, zodat Google de pagina in de cache voor u kan weergeven.

4. Meld u aan bij uw domeinregistreerder en ga naar het hostrecordgedeelte voor uw domein. Voor NameCheap hebt u toegang via de koppeling "Alle hostrecords" onder het gedeelte "Hostbeheer". Voor GoDaddy is dit onder de sectie DNS Manager. De onderstaande instructies zijn voor NameCheap.

U zou een "www" in uw Hosts Record moeten zien. In de meeste gevallen moet worden gewezen op hetzelfde IP-adres als het record "@".

Dit zijn de dingen die je moet veranderen:

  • Verander het IP-adres in " pagespeed.googlehosted.com " (zonder het citaat). In sommige gevallen moet u aan het einde een "." ( Punt ) toevoegen (" pagespeed.googlehosted.com. ").
  • Wijzig vervolgens het recordtype van "A" in "CNAME"
  • Sla de wijzigingen op

Dat is het. Nu hoeft u alleen maar te wachten totdat de DNS-wijzigingen zich via het web verspreiden (het kan wel 24 uur duren). Voor degenen die geen gebruik maken van NameCheap, kunt u de instructies hier voor uw domeinregistreerder bekijken.

5. Last but not least, wil je misschien al je bezoekers omleiden van het "niet-www" -domein (http://example.com) naar het "www" -domein (http://www.example.com) dus de cacheversie van PageSpeed ​​Service wordt altijd weergegeven. Voor een Apache-server die een .htaccess-bestand ondersteunt, kunt u dit item helemaal boven aan uw .htaccess-bestand toevoegen:

 RewriteEngine On RewriteCond% {HTTP_HOST} ^ example.com RewriteRule (. *) Http://www.example.com/$1 [R = 301, L] 

Vergeet niet om "example.com" in uw eigen domeinnaam te veranderen.

Paginasnelheidvergelijking

Nadat u Paginasnelheid-service op uw site hebt ingesteld, kunt u nu een paginasnelheidstest uitvoeren en de prestatieverbetering bekijken. Klik in de Google API-console op de link "Snelheidstest uitvoeren". Deze brengt u naar de pagina waar u de snelheidstest kunt uitvoeren.

Nu kunt u achterover leunen en genieten van de snelheidsboost.

Update : Zoals gevraagd, hier is het resultaat van de snelheidstest voor MakeTechEasier na gebruik van PageSpeed ​​Service:

Zoals te zien is, is er een verbetering van de laadtijd met 24, 5% en een verbetering van de snelheidsindex van 42, 1%. Ik zou het nog sneller kunnen laten laden door de luie laadfunctie te activeren, maar het veroorzaakt problemen met de afbeeldingen, dus ik moet het deactiveren.